NAGPUR: The Delhi-based entertainment, content and sporting rights firm,

Stracon India Ltd., has launched an Internet enabled gaming console, ‘Dreamcast’

in Nagpur. Dreamcast is a product of Sega Corporation, Japan. Stracon now plans

to market Dreamcast in Maharashtra and Gujarat, within a couple of months.

Stracon vice president (sales and marketing), Sunil Sethi said: "Dreamcast

is a highly affordable and effective medium not only for top-notch entertainment

but also for more young consumers to become part of the Internet revolution. It

is a 128-bit, game console with built-in 56k modem, that can be used as a

network terminal for high speed Internet connections. It also doubles as an

audio CD player.

By moderately pricing Dreamcast and its software, we expect the product to

increase the Net penetration in the country. In this regard, we expect

Maharashtra and Gujarat to contribute 30 per cent of out top line revenues, with

cities like Pune and Nagpur leading this way."

Dreamcast hopes to focus on children and teenagers. The built-in Internet

connection will pick up, as favorable conditions prevail in the markets, such as

rapid increase in Net usage, he said. The firm, which was expecting a

substantial chunk of sales from Nagpur, Pune, Surat, Ahmedabad and Mumbai, is

targeting first year sales of 1 lakh units with an expected sales revenue of

over Rs 100 crore.

In order to maximize its reach, Stracon will push Dreamcast through multiple

channels and place it in a wide variety of retail outlets. Apart from retail

distribution, Stracon will also use the services of direst sales agents,

corporate sales super retailers and the Internet. In the retail segment, Stracon

will be extending Dreamcast in white and brown goods showroom, computer hardware

and peripherals stores, telecom equipment shops, super markets, video & VCD

libraries and select lifestyle retailers such as fashion outlets.

Stracon will also make available all of Sega's world famous game titles at a

highly affordable price. Stracon India aims at bringing in Sega's entire top

rated gaming titles on CD-ROM.
